Understanding the Swedish Driving License System
The Swedish Transport Agency, referred to as Transportstyrelsen, oversees all driving license matters in Sweden. The company has made substantial development in digitizing its services, enabling lots of elements of the application and renewal procedures to be completed online. This digital transformation indicates that applicants can now manage much of the governmental workflow without needing to go to government offices in individual.
A Swedish driving license is recognized throughout the European Union and European Economic Area, making it an important document for those preparing to travel or transfer within Europe. The license stands for 10 years before needing renewal, though medical requirements may demand earlier renewals for particular classifications or age groups.
Eligibility Requirements for Swedish Driving Licenses
Before beginning the application procedure, people should verify that they satisfy the basic eligibility criteria. Applicants must be at least 16 years of age for a moped license and 18 years for a basic automobile license. Beyond age requirements, candidates should also have a legitimate Swedish personal identity number (personnummer), which is essential for all official negotiations with Swedish authorities.
Medical fitness constitutes another critical requirement. Körkort driving license applicants should go through a medical evaluation performed by an authorized doctor. This examination assesses vision, cardiovascular health, diabetes management, and other conditions that may impact driving ability. The medical certificate must be dated no greater than 2 years before the license application is submitted.
The Step-by-Step Application Process
The journey toward a Swedish driving license follows a structured path that prospects should browse systematically. Comprehending each stage assists applicants prepare sufficiently and prevent unnecessary hold-ups.
Stage One: Theory Testing
Before any practical driving starts, applicants should pass a theoretical examination, referred to as the körprov. This test assesses understanding of Swedish traffic rules, road indications, threat perception, and ecological factors to consider. The theory test includes 65 concerns, and candidates must achieve at least 52 proper responses to pass. Lots of driving schools use comprehensive preparation courses and practice tests that closely mirror the actual assessment format.
Phase Two: Practical Training
Following successful theory testing, prospects go through practical driving instruction with certified driving instructors. The compulsory training consists of particular parts such as night driving, driving on highways, and safety maneuvers. The number of driving lessons differs based upon private ability level and prior experience, however the majority of candidates require in between 15 and 25 hours of practical direction.
Stage Three: Practical Examination
The final difficulty is the useful driving test, that includes both a security check examination and an on-road driving assessment. Inspectors examine the prospect's capability to handle numerous traffic situations, demonstrate correct observation strategies, and run the lorry securely under varied conditions.
Alternatives for EU and EEA License Holders
People holding valid driving licenses from other European Union or European Economic Area nations might be qualified to exchange their existing license for a Swedish equivalent without completing the complete testing procedure. This provision uses to licenses that are currently legitimate and were acquired in the license holder's native land.
The exchange process can be started through the Transport Agency's online website. Candidates must offer their original license, proof of identity, a Swedish address verification, and a picture meeting main specs. Processing times for license exchanges usually vary from 2 to 4 weeks, though this can differ based on application volume and verification requirements.

Cost Considerations and Budget Planning
Comprehending the monetary investment required for a Swedish driving license helps prospects prepare their budgets successfully. Costs vary significantly based upon private situations, prior experience, and the variety of lessons needed.
Expense Category
Common Cost (SEK)
Notes
Medical Examination
300-600
Differs by doctor
Theory Test
325
Per attempt
Practical Test
800
Per effort
Driving Lessons (per hour)
450-650
Differs by instructor
Course Materials
300-800
Books, online access
License Issuance
250
After passing all tests
Most candidates report total costs between 8,000 and 15,000 Swedish Kronor, though those requiring additional lessons or retests need to budget for greater amounts.
Common Challenges and Solutions
Numerous prospects encounter problems throughout the licensing process, and comprehending these difficulties ahead of time enables better preparation.
Time management provides a significant barrier for busy grownups stabilizing work, family, and other dedications. The practical option includes thorough advance planning and making the most of weekend and evening lesson options that many driving schools provide. Reserving theory and dry runs well beforehand ensures availability during favored time slots.
Language barriers can make complex the knowing process for non-native Swedish speakers. While the theory test is readily available in a number of languages consisting of English, some prospects find that studying in Swedish much better prepares them for real-world driving scenarios where road sign terminology and instructions may be delivered specifically in Swedish.
Test anxiety impacts numerous prospects, sometimes resulting in repeated failures. Driving schools often use specialized preparation for worried candidates, consisting of relaxation strategies and substantial mock examination practice that builds confidence through familiarity with the screening format.
Frequently Asked Questions
Can I utilize my non-EU driving license in Sweden?
Non-EU license holders might drive with their original license for as much as one year after ending up being registered residents in Sweden. After this duration, the license must either be exchanged (if Sweden has a mutual arrangement with the issuing country) or changed through the complete Swedish screening procedure.
The length of time is the Swedish driving license legitimate?
Requirement Swedish driving licenses stay legitimate for 10 years from the problem date. Nevertheless, license holders need to renew their license before reaching age 70 if they wish to continue driving, and medical certificates might be needed more frequently for older chauffeurs or those with certain medical conditions.
Is online theory test preparation enough for passing the actual assessment?
Online preparation products, when utilized diligently, supply exceptional preparation for the theory assessment. The official Transport Agency site offers practice tests that accurately show the format and trouble of the actual evaluation. Numerous prospects successfully pass after completing only online preparation, though classroom guideline may benefit those who prefer structured learning environments.
What takes place if I fail the practical driving test?
Failed prospects receive comprehensive feedback recognizing locations needing improvement. There is no mandatory waiting period in between attempts, though trainers normally advise extra practice before re-examination. Each attempt requires payment of the examination charge, making extensive preparation financially advantageous.
Can I take the driving tests in English?
The theory evaluation is available in Swedish, English, Arabic, Persian, and several other languages. The useful driving test can be conducted in English if asked for when reserving the assessment, though examiners are not required to speak English with complete confidence. Candidates should think about whether their English proficiency suffices for comprehending complicated verbal guidelines throughout the test.
